RSSB Rajasthan Driver Result 2026 – Complete Overview

The Rajasthan Staff Selection Board is expected to release the official results for the Driver recruitment exam around January 2026. The result will be published on the official portal rssb.rajasthan.gov.in. Candidates who appeared in the written examination conducted on 23 November 2025 can check their scores, merit lists, and cut-off marks as soon as the results are announced. The result is typically presented as a merit list displaying roll numbers and candidate details along with the category-wise cut-off scores.

Key Details and Important Dates

Recruitment and Examination Timeline

Event Date Status
Application Start 27 February 2025 Completed
Application End 28 March 2025 Completed
Admit Card Release 19 November 2025 Released
Written Examination 23 November 2025 Completed
Answer Key Release 09 December 2025 Released
Result Declaration January 2026 (Tentative) Expected Soon
Next Stage (Driving/Skill Test & Document Verification) To be announced Upcoming

Preparation for Next Stages

Once qualified, candidates will be called for the following stages based on the recruitment process:

  • Driving Test / Skill Test: Practical assessment of driving skills for light and heavy vehicles.
  • Document Verification: Checking original documents such as ID, proof of eligibility, and experience certificates.
  • Medical Examination: Ensuring physical and medical fitness as per requirement.
